What is Flip-Flop Circuit, Definitions, Advantage & Disadvantage

Authored By: Ankita Prajapati

A flip-flop circuit is a type of electronic device that is used to store binary data. It is a two-state digital circuit, meaning that it can only be in one of two possible states—“on” or “off”—at any given time. Flip-flops are the foundation of digital logic, and they are used to control and direct the flow of data in a number of digital systems.

A flip-flop is made up of two main components: a latch and a gated input. The latch is the part that stores the data, while the gated input is used to control the data flow. The flip-flop is then connected to a clock, which provides a signal that tells the flip-flop when to change its state.

Flip-flops can also be used to synchronize two separate clock signals in order to reduce power consumption.

Join the vibrant Electrical & Electronics Engineers community

This is especially useful in applications where two separate clocks need to be synchronized.

Synchronizing two clocks can reduce the amount of power needed to power the system and can also reduce the amount of heat generated by the system, which can be beneficial in many applications.

Join Engineering Communities and Events related to your Career Path.

campus cover

Advantages

One of the main advantages of flip-flops is that they can store data even when the power is off. This makes them useful for storing data in memory.

Flip-flops can also be used to store data in a system’s registers, which is useful for controlling the flow of data in a system.

Flip-flops are also capable of providing timing signals and can be used to generate complex waveforms.

Disadvantages

One of the main disadvantages of flip-flops is that they are susceptible to noise.

If a system is exposed to too much noise, it can cause the flip-flop to switch states at random, which can cause the system to malfunction.

In order to prevent this, it is important to use shielding and filtering to reduce the amount of noise that is present in a system.

Join the vibrant Electrical & Electronics Engineers community

Conclusion

Overall, flip-flops are a useful and versatile type of digital circuit that can be used to store data, provide timing signals, and synchronize two separate clock signals.

While they can be susceptible to noise, this can be mitigated by using proper shielding and filtering. Flip-flops are an essential part of digital logic and are used in a wide variety of applications.

Join Engineering Communities and Events related to your Career Path.

campus cover

Related Resources:

Deep dive into Engineering, Join millions like you

final bottom cover